    Abstract: A plug-in circuit breaker with an operating button that includes a button inner end inserted inside the circuit breaker and a button outer end. An indicator slot is arranged inside the operating button, an indicating hole is arranged on the button outer end. The plug-in circuit breaker further includes an indicating member slidably inserted inside the indicator slot and one end of which is provided with a make-contact indicating surface and a break-contact indicating surface. When the plug-in circuit breaker is in a break-contact state, the break-contact indicating surface is arranged opposite to the indicating hole, thus during pressing the operating button, the indicating member moves inside the indicator slot. After the make-contact state, the make-contact indicating surface is arranged opposite to the indicating hole. The indicating member is arranged inside the operating button to save space and to indicate the break-contact and make-contact state through the indicating hole.

    Abstract: A miniature circuit breaker, which includes a circuit breaker housing, a button mechanism, and an indicating apparatus. The circuit breaker housing includes an indicating hole arranged in one side thereof, the button mechanism is in sliding fit with the circuit breaker housing, the indicating apparatus is in driving fit with the button mechanism, and when the button mechanism is pressed to switch on the miniature circuit breaker, the button mechanism drives the indicating apparatus to shield the indicating hole. The indicating apparatus thereof may indicate a switching-on state of the circuit breaker when the circuit breaker is switched on, thus improving a safety of electricity consumption.

    Abstract: The present disclosure relates to a photoresist composition, a method for preparing the same, and a patterning method. The photoresist composition includes: 1 wt % to 10 wt % of a photosensitizer; 10 wt % to 20 wt % of a phenolic resin; 0.1 wt % to 5.5 wt % of an additive; and 75 wt % to 88 wt % of a solvent, based on the total weight of the photoresist composition, in which the photosensitizer includes: 20 wt % to 70 wt % of a first photosensitive compound represented by formula (1), 20 wt % to 70 wt % of a second photosensitive compound represented by formula (2), and 1 wt % to 35 wt % of a third photosensitive compound represented by formula (3), based on the total weight of the photosensitizer. The photoresist composition of the present disclosure simultaneously guarantees high resolution and high sensitivity, and can meet actual production requirements.

    Abstract: A lead-free sealing glass and a manufacture method thereof are provided. The lead-free sealing glass includes: 30 wt %-60 wt % of SiO2, 10 wt %-30 wt % of BaO, 1 wt %-5 wt % of Na2O, 1 wt %-10 wt % of K2O, 2 wt %-10 wt % of V2O5, 5 wt %-10 wt % of CaO, 1 wt %-5 wt % of Al2O3, 0 wt %-5 wt % of B2O3, 1 wt %-3 wt % of Fe2O3, and 0-5 wt % of alkaline earth metal oxide.

    Abstract: A fuse appliance has a fuse carrier for receiving a fuse and a base. The fuse carrier is in a cavity of the base and is manually operable to remove or insert the fuse. Fixed contacts are provided on the base which engage with moving contacts provided on the carrier. Wiring terminals are electrically connected to the fixed contacts. A rotational-linear pulling operation mechanism has a semicircular rotary shaft structure that has two semicircular convex shafts and first and second circular straight grooves fitted to each other so that the fuse carrier performs rotational and linear movements relative to the base and an interchange between rotational and linear movements at a transition position when the carrier is pulled out of or pushed into the appliance.
